#BeardGang: 4 Things to note in grooming your beards

June 16,2017
Share:

By Patricia Uyeh

The beards are wonderful parts of a man’s facial features.

These days, it has become a ” fashion item” becoming more prominent now that the #BeardGang is trending.

It is being popularised by Nigerian celebrities like Noble Igwe, Praiz, Jidenna, Lynxxx, OC Ukeje, Desmond Elliot, DJ Obi amongst others.

Ask any of them, keeping beards is cool but it requires a lot of effort and care. As a guy, here are things to note to groom your beards:

1 . Choose a style
This depends on the shape of your jaws. You can go for low maintenance or high maintenance beards depending on what you can handle. Remember grooming your beards requires a lot of patience.

2.Invest in beard shampoo and conditioner
To avoid skin irritation, use beard shampoo and conditioners regularly. Once you stop shaving, the skin produces dead cells, so to get rid of them, you have to wash your beards with beard shampoo and conditioner for proper care. Don’t use scalp hair shampoos as this could lead to more irritations.

3. Brush beard regularly
The beard can’t fend for itself so you need beard brush and comb to groom it. Brush the beard outward to know areas that need trimming then you can then brush downward afterwards. If you don’t know a good barber to help with the trimming of your beard, try to learn how to use a beard trimmer.

4. Eat with care
Now that you have joined the beard gang you have to be careful with what you eat. You don’t want to eat okro or ewedu and allow it spill on your beards. Follow good diet habits and eat well to allow beards grow well.
